What is your favorite hand crafted gift made by your child?


I don’t think I have a favorite item from my children, both of them have 
made me items out of salt dough that they handcrafted, dried out and then 
painted. My daughter has made me bracelets and necklaces And they both made 
me cards as well as other crafts. I think I still have every single thing 
they have made me.

What type of things have you made for your mother?

I made my mom a few bath bombs for Mother’s Day this year, I’ve made her 
blankets and a water bottle holder, I have made baskets out of Pineneedles 
they’re very time-consuming but look beautiful when complete.




Did your mother teach you a craft and if so what was it?
My mom does quilting and scrapbooking. I’ve asked my mom to show me how to 
use my sewing machine but she hasn’t had a chance to do so yet, it’s been 
about two years so I’m not sure that’s ever going to happen.

Do you and your mother craft together and if so what kind of projects do you 
enjoy sharing?

My mom and I don’t really craft together but we do garden together.
I am planning on teaching my daughter how to loom knit this summer though, I’m 
really excited for this.
